Job description

What this Department does:

The individual will work within the Asset Integrity Engineering department in support of multiple engineering projects. Asset Integrity is responsible for maintaining and executing the Integrity Management Program and maintaining integrity for all of Tallgrass’ pipeline and facilities. The department reviews integrity threats to Tallgrass’ assets to determine how and when to inspect them and supports the execution of these inspections. In addition to executing the Integrity Management Program, Asset Integrity supports pipeline and facility integrity outside of High Consequence Areas (HCAs) through inspection, external and internal corrosion prevention, and geohazard mitigation programs.

Responsibilities
What You'll Do

The individual in this role will assist with sustaining pipeline integrity management programs for Tallgrass’ assets. This includes collaborating with different departments such as Corrosion, Technical Services, and GIS and Engineering Records to work on projects such as class location studies, material verification, and in-line inspections. The role will also assist with data integration and quality assurance for Asset Integrity projects and staying updated on industry’s best practices.

You Can Expect To
  • Develop and apply an understanding of pipeline integrity management for liquid and gas pipelines and facilities.
  • Work with several different departments including but not limited to Corrosion, Technical Services, Project Management, GIS and Engineering Records, Measurement, and Field Operations.
  • Work on multiple different Asset Integrity Engineering projects including but not limited to class location studies, material verification projects, MAOP reconfirmation, cyclic fatigue assessment, in-line inspections, and corrosion mitigation.
  • Assist Asset Integrity with data integration and quality assurance for Asset Integrity projects.
  • Review industry best practices and guidance while applying these standards within Tallgrass’ Asset Integrity team.
